★NATURAL ATTRACTIONS★
Set on the Muskegon River amid Northern Michigan's forests and famous inland lakes, the natural beauty begins at your door: 🚤 Lakes – Houghton Lake (≈25 min), Higgins Lake (≈35 min), Lake Cadillac & Lake Mitchell (≈40 min) 🏖️ Beaches – Houghton Lake public beaches (≈25 min), North & South Higgins Lake State Park (≈35 min) 🌲 Public Lands – Thousands of acres of adjoining public and national forests (on-site), plus the Pere Marquette & Au Sable State Forests 🏃♀️ Hiking Trails – Wooded trails into the neighboring public lands (on-site) and nearby state-forest pathways

★FURTHER AWAY★
Paradise Pines Retreat makes an easy base for exploring Northern Michigan's best day trips: → Houghton Lake – 25 min: Michigan's largest inland lake, with boating, marinas, waterfront dining, and year-round water fun → Lake City – 30 min: Missaukee county seat with lakeside parks and small-town shops and eateries → Higgins Lake – 35 min: Famously clear water, two state-park beaches, and some of the state's best swimming → Cadillac – 40 min: Lakes Cadillac and Mitchell, waterfront dining, shopping, and winter trails → Grayling – 45 min: The legendary Au Sable River, canoeing, and fly-fishing history → Clare – 50 min: The "Gateway to the North" and home of the famous Cops & Doughnuts bakery → Traverse City – 1 hr: Wineries, Lake Michigan beaches, and Sleeping Bear Dunes → Mount Pleasant – 1 hr 5 min: Soaring Eagle casino resort and Central Michigan University
